New Nice Urls

The site now features nice urls, nice as in readable, for most content. This is supposedly really good for search engines and also it is way better for us humans to have a url that actually means something.

In Drupal this can be easily achieved with the pathauto module that depends on path and token modules. Easily, is of course relative Sticking out tongue

I've been putting this work off for a long time mainly because it requires you to think about how your site should be organized. This is actually quite hard, since your decisions tend to live for a long time. Also it involves a somewhat risky bulk update of the site and database. These things are always a bit scary to do.

My plan of attack was to use a test installation and make experiments on it, and then go live. I spent a few hours last night making the changes and it did take a while before I got the hang of it and found a structure that I was satisfied with.

Then came the live part Sticking out tongue... actually things went great. The servers we are currently running on is way faster than my private dedicated setup, so the update was made in a few seconds. As of now all seems to work just fine. Yay!
